NCT ID: NCT00435201 Completed - Hepatitis C Clinical Trials

Characterization of Clonal B Cell Populations in HCV Infection

Start date: January 2007
Phase: N/A
Study type: Observational

The purpose of this study is to investigate the mechanism of autoantibody production during chronic hepatitis C virus (HCV) infection. 10-50% of individuals with HCV have symptoms of mixed cryoglobulinemia (MC). By studying the B cells from HCV-infected individuals with and without MC, as well as from healthy controls, we hope to gain insight into the mechanisms of autoantibody production and develop new strategies for treatment of MC.

NCT ID: NCT00433108 Completed - Chronic Hepatitis C Clinical Trials

Trial of MitoQ for Raised Liver Enzymes Due to Hepatitis C

Start date: March 2007
Phase: Phase 2
Study type: Interventional

A Phase 2, randomized, double-blind, parallel design trial of two doses of mitoquinone mesylate (MitoQ) and of placebo in patients with chronic Hepatitis C. MitoQ is a mitochondria-targeted antioxidant that rapidly permeates the lipid bilayer and accumulates within mitochondria in organs such as liver, brain, heart, skeletal muscle. There is strong evidence for increased oxidative stress and mitochondrial damage leading to apoptosis via caspase activation. Several studies have shown that MitoQ protects cells from apoptosis by acting as a caspase inhibitor and may be effective in reducing cell damage in liver disease. It is hypothesised that administration of MitoQ will lower raised ALT seen in patients with chronic Hepatitis C compared with placebo. Approximately 36 patients who have been unresponsive or not suitable for interferon-based therapy will be enrolled at one centre. Treatment duration will be 28 days with 28 days post-treatment follow-up.

NCT ID: NCT00423800 Terminated - Clinical trials for Hepatitis C, Chronic

Efficacy and Safety of 24 vs 48 Weeks of Pegetron® (Peginterferon Alfa-2b + Ribavirin) in Naïve Genotype 1 Hepatitis C (Study P05016)(TERMINATED)

Start date: December 2006
Phase: Phase 3
Study type: Interventional

This is a Phase IIIB randomized, controlled, multi-centre, open-label study of 24 versus 48 weeks therapy with Pegetron® (peginterferon alfa-2b + ribavirin) at standard doses in naïve Hepatitis C Virus (HCV) genotype 1 high viral load (HVL) participants who are Hepatitis C Virus-Ribonucleic Acid (HCV-RNA) negative at Week 4. HVL will be defined as HCV-RNA of >600,000 IU/mL prior to the initiation of therapy. Participants with genotype 1 baseline HVL prescribed Pegetron® (peginterferon and ribavirin) in the usual manner in accordance with the marketing authorization and who are viral negative at Week 4 will be randomized at Week 8 to receive a total of 24 or 48 weeks of therapy. Participants will be required to have their baseline and Week-12 viral load analyzed by the same local laboratory using the standard of care test used by the site. Qualitative testing at Week 4, 8, 16-20, 24, and 48 may be conducted either by local laboratory or a central laboratory identified by the sponsor using an assay specified by the sponsor. No additional interventions outside of the clinic's standard of care and the conditions of the Canadian product monograph for Pegetron® will be applied to participants.

NCT ID: NCT00423670 Completed - Chronic Hepatitis C Clinical Trials

Safety and Efficacy of SCH 503034 in Previously Untreated Subjects With Chronic Hepatitis C Infected With Genotype 1 (Study P03523)

Start date: January 2007
Phase: Phase 2
Study type: Interventional

This was an open-label, randomized safety and efficacy trial in adult, treatment-naïve Chronic Hepatitis C (CHC) participants with genotype 1 infection. The study conducted in 2 parts, compared standard-of-care PegIntron (1.5 μg/kg, once weekly [QW]), plus ribavirin (800 to 1400 mg/day), for 48 weeks to five treatment paradigms containing boceprevir (SCH 503034) 800 mg thrice a day (TID). The five treatments included boceprevir (BOC) plus standard-of-care for 28 or 48 weeks, with and without a 4-week lead-in with PegIntron (PEG) and ribavirin (RBV), and exploration of PegIntron plus low-dose ribavirin (400 to 1000 mg/day) plus boceprevir for 48 weeks.
